AutoPilot AI has an overall score of 5.2/10 and operates on a paid pricing model, typically targeting users who require advanced automation features. PandaDoc scores slightly higher at 5.3/10 and offers a freemium pricing structure, making it accessible for users seeking document automation with basic features available for free and premium options for advanced needs. While AutoPilot AI focuses more on AI-driven automation workflows, PandaDoc is primarily designed for document creation, management, and e-signatures.
ⓘ How Volvenix scores work
Scores are computed by Volvenix — not supplied by the vendors, and not third-party benchmark results. Each 0–10 dimension (Overall, Features, Usability, Support, Pricing) is a directional estimate aggregated from catalog signals — editorial cataloguing, content depth, engagement, and provider-reputation indicators — so treat them as a starting point, not a lab result.
